Innovative and Integrated Design of the Properties Experiments of Concentrated Sulfuric Acid

Abstract  This paper designed several properties experiments of concentrated sulfuric acid including water absorption, dehydration property, strong oxidizing property, exothermic property when contacts water and catalytic property, which solved disadvantages of related experiments in the textbook, such as large consumption of drugs, not easy to operate, easy spill of drugs, easy to pollute water, time-consuming, not suitable for the grouping experiments. The integrated and innovative experiments were green, easy and safe to operate, which were suitable for students to carry out extra-curricular activities.
